It is important to note that crime rates are influenced by various factors such as socioeconomic status, education level, and community environment. Making generalizations about crime rates based on race can perpetuate harmful stereotypes. It is more accurate to focus on addressing the root causes of crime and promoting equality and justice for all individuals, regardless of their race.
